Split a group receipt, then actually settle it, with proof at every step.
Photograph a bill and FINALTab works out who owes what, to the cent. Each person approves their own share from their own wallet. Nobody, including FINALTab, can move the money without those signatures, and the payment is only reported as done once an independent check confirms it really landed.
In precise terms: turn a shared receipt into an exact, externally signed USDC settlement, route the transaction through KeeperHub, and refuse to call it settled until both KeeperHub and an independent Base Sepolia check prove it landed.

Worth being precise about, because "AI agent" is doing a lot of work in most submissions:
| Step | Who decides | Can it move money? |
|---|---|---|
| Reading the receipt | Vision model | No |
| Working out each share | Deterministic engine, integer minor units | No |
| Four-stage review | Bounded review over validity, arithmetic, consent risk, proof preflight | No, it can only block Freeze |
| Approving a share | The debtor, in their own wallet | Only by signing |
| Approving the broadcast | A permitted human wallet, on a short-lived bound challenge | Only by signing |
| Executing | KeeperHub | Yes, and only against those signatures |
| Confirming | Independent Base Sepolia receipt and event check | No, it can only refuse to confirm |
A model never chooses or authorizes value movement. The agent's autonomy is the authority to stop a settlement, never to release one.

- Extract. A vision model returns structured receipt lines. Model output is schema-checked and never trusted for arithmetic.
- Allocate. The engine converts decimal strings to integer minor units and applies deterministic largest-remainder allocation so shares reconcile exactly.
- Net. The debt graph is reduced deterministically to at most
n-1transfers. FINALTab does not claim that greedy netting is globally minimal. - Review. The first-party UI commits an attested four-stage review. Editing the receipt, participants, payer, or allocation invalidates that review.
- Freeze. Only the current accepted review can unlock Freeze. Canonical ledger and complete V2 debit/payout plan hashes lock the state wallets review, using the durable receipt UUID rather than a browser-only slug.
- Consent. Every debtor's external wallet signs Circle USDC
ReceiveWithAuthorizationand FINALTabSettlementConsent. The server does not hold arbitrary user keys. - Simulate. KeeperHub simulates the exact signed V2 call before any broadcast request.
- Approve. A permitted human wallet reviews and EIP-191-signs a short-lived challenge bound to the authenticated API principal, chain, V2 contract, ledger, and plan.
- Execute and verify. The first-party UI, REST, and MCP value-moving paths
share one service-authored durable intent journal before KeeperHub receives a
deterministic idempotent call. An accepted replay returns the recorded
execution without another simulation or execution; prepared crash recovery
reuses the stored successful simulation and the same idempotency key while
the persisted approval lease remains bounded. Fresh first-party execution
still requires current database approvals and a valid wallet approval at the
final pre-broadcast gate.
VERIFIED_SETTLEDrequires a successful KeeperHub receipt plus an independently fetched receipt whose indexed settlementId and ledgerHash match the frozen plan.

- All money arithmetic uses integer minor units; floats never touch balances.
- USD 2-decimal minor units map to USDC 6-decimal units at face value. Other currencies may split but are refused for onchain settlement without an explicit conversion source.
- The model proposes; the deterministic engine decides and reconciles.
ReceiveWithAuthorizationnames the settlement contract as recipient.- V2
SettlementConsentbinds the complete ordered debit/payout plan. - Invalid signature, nonce, expiry, consent, replay, or conservation reverts the atomic batch.
- A hash or
completedstatus alone is never settlement proof.
